Tips for Healthy Living 7-15-2016
A live 15-minute conversation about health and health news from the Sunshine Community Health Center: It’s hosted by Holly Stinson, with in-studio guest Keith Kehoe, Physician Assistant at the clinic.

On this program, Keith talks about the relationship between chicken pox and shingles, how to identify an outbreak of shingles, and why he recommends a shingles vaccine for people in their sixties.
Keith also wants people to know about a free four-day camp for young people 15 to 21 who might be interested in careers in behavioral health, a field which has too few providers in Alaska. The camp starts August 1st in Anchorage.
